WebTraditional forms are aku (skipjack tuna) and heʻe (octopus). Heʻe (octopus) poke is usually called by its Japanese name tako poke, except in places like the island of Niʻihau where the Hawaiian language is spoken. Increasingly popular ahi poke is made with yellowfin tuna. Web18 jun. 2024 · It is made from raw ahi (tuna), soy sauce, sesame oil, green onions, and sweet onions. Poke counter at Foodland (Ala Moana, Oahu location). There is another popular style of poke called Hawaiian-Style Poke. This version has raw ahi, Hawaiian sea salt, inamona (kukui nuts, also called candlenuts), and limu kohu or ogo (seaweed). bitlife halloween challenge

Web15 jul. 2024 · It’s unclear as to where the dish originated, but the present form of poké became popular around the 1970s. It used skinned, deboned, and filleted raw fish served with Hawaiian salt, seaweed, and roasted, ground candlenut meat. This form of poké is still common in the Hawaiian islands.
